Vinaya Vidheya Rama Box Office Collections (Day 4): Shows Good Growth Over The Sankranthi Break

Ram Charan is one of the most talented and sought-after young stars in the Tollywood today. He enjoys an enviable fan following because of his gripping screen presence and effective performances. During his career, the 'Mega Powerstar' has starred in quite a few big movies and this has helped him prove his mettle as a performer. At present, he is in the limelight because of his latest release Vinaya Vidheya Rama.

The action-drama hit the screens on January 11, 2019 and opened to a decent response at the box office. As per the latest report, it showed good growth over the weekend and beat the negative talk like a boss.

According to a leading website, Vinaya Vidheya Rama made full use of the festival season and showed good growth over the weekend in the Telugu states. It collected a share of Rs 4 Crore on Saturday(January 12, 2019). It raked in the same amount on Sunday(January 13, 2019). Its Monday share is likely to be around Rs 6 Crore. The four-day share is likely to be around Rs 46 Crore.

VVR collected nearly Rs 94 Crore through pre-release business and became a career best for Ram Charan. The film's box office fate will also show whether Mr C is capable of delivering back-2-back hits or not. As such, the stakes are pretty high.

The general is that Vinaya Vidheya Rama is a pretty underwhelming film and it fails to offer anything fresh to the fans. Most viewers have also stated the lazy screenplay and the mindless violence are VVR's biggest drawbacks. Ram Charan's performance too has received flak from a certain section of the audience. As such, the WOM is quite negative. And, needless to say, this might prove to be a cause of worry for the Vinaya Vidheya Rama team in the coming days.

Vinaya Vidheya Rama is likely to register good numbers on Tuesday(January 15, 2019) and remain the top choice of the target audience. It will, however, be interesting to see whether it is able to hold up once the festival season ends.
